Number of Solutions In Exercises 63-66, state why the system of equations must have at least one solution. Then solve the system and determine whether it has exactly one solution or infinitely many solutions.

\(\begin{array}{l} 2 x+3 y=0 \\ 4 x+3 y-z=0 \\ 8 x+3 y+3 z=0 \end{array} \)
